Skip to main content
assistive.skiplink.to.breadcrumbs
assistive.skiplink.to.header.menu
assistive.skiplink.to.action.menu
assistive.skiplink.to.quick.search
Log in
Confluence
Spaces
Hit enter to search
Help
Online Help
Keyboard Shortcuts
Feed Builder
What’s new
Available Gadgets
About Confluence
Log in
SEI CERT C++ Coding Standard
Pages
Boards
Space shortcuts
Dashboard
Secure Coding Home
Android
C
C++
Java
Perl
Page tree
Browse pages
Configure
Space tools
View Page
Page History
Page Information
View in Hierarchy
View Source
Export to PDF
Pages
…
SEI CERT C++ Coding Standard
2 Rules
Rule 08. Exceptions and Error Handling (ERR)
ERR58-CPP. Handle all exceptions thrown before main() begins executing
Page History
Versions Compared
Old Version
11
changes.mady.by.user
Aaron Ballman
Saved on
Jan 15, 2015
compared with
New Version
12
changes.mady.by.user
Aaron Ballman
Saved on
Feb 03, 2015
Previous Change: Difference between versions 10 and 11
Next Change: Difference between versions 12 and 13
View Page History
Key
This line was added.
This line was removed.
Formatting was changed.
Comment:
xref; NFC
...
CERT C++ Coding Standard
ERR30-CPP. Only call std::terminate(), std::abort(), or std::_Exit() directly
ERR37-CPP. Honor exception specifications
DCL40-CPP. Destructors and deallocation functions must be declared noexcept
...
Overview
Content Tools
{"serverDuration": 134, "requestCorrelationId": "6424397f05999d56"}